Lemon Cheesecake Minis Recipe Ingredients
For the Cheesecake Filling
- Cream Cheese – ensures a silky, creamy texture; use at room temperature for easy blending.
- Granulated Sugar – sweetens the cheesecake while balancing the tartness of the lemon.
- Lemon Zest – adds aromatic citrus flavor; always opt for fresh zests for the best taste.
- Eggs – binds the cheesecake, contributing to a delicate, rich texture.
- Vanilla Extract – enhances flavor with a warm, mellow undertone.
- Fresh Lemon Juice – delivers bright acidity, making the flavors pop.
For the Crust
- Vanilla Wafer Cookies – provides a crunchy, buttery base; substitute with graham crackers for a different texture.
For Topping
- Lemon Curd – adds a luscious citrus topping; can be homemade or store-bought to complement your Lemon Cheesecake Minis Recipe.
- Fresh Raspberries (Optional) – offer a burst of tartness and a pop of color for a stunning presentation.
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Lemon Cheesecake Minis Recipe
Step 1: Preheat the Oven and Prepare Muffin Cups
Preheat your oven to 325°F (160°C) and line a standard 12-cup muffin tin with paper liners. This preparation ensures easy removal of the Lemon Cheesecake Minis once baked and adds a touch of charm. As the oven heats, gather your mixing bowls and a hand mixer for a smooth, easy blending process.
Step 2: Beat the Cream Cheese
In a large mixing bowl, beat the softened cream cheese with a hand mixer on medium speed for about 2 minutes until it’s completely smooth and creamy. The perfect consistency should be lump-free and velvety. This step sets the foundation for your creamy filling, ensuring your Lemon Cheesecake Minis have that delightful texture.
Step 3: Combine Sugar and Lemon Zest
Next, in a separate bowl, mix together granulated sugar and lemon zest. Stir this mixture into the whipped cream cheese and continue beating on medium speed until the mixture is fluffy, which should take about 1 minute. You’ll notice the citrus aroma come alive, enhancing the flavor of your future Lemon Cheesecake Minis.
Step 4: Add Eggs and Flavorings
Add the eggs to the creamy mixture, one at a time. Mix in the vanilla extract and fresh lemon juice, combining on low speed until fully incorporated. Be cautious not to overmix at this stage to prevent cracks in the cheesecakes. The filling should appear smooth, with a slight sheen, reflecting the brightness of the lemon juice.
Step 5: Assemble the Cups
Place a vanilla wafer cookie, flat-side down, at the bottom of each muffin cup. Carefully spoon the luscious cheesecake batter over the cookies, filling each cup until it’s about two-thirds full. This step combines a delightful crunch with the creamy filling, forming the perfect base for your Lemon Cheesecake Minis.
Step 6: Bake the Mini Cheesecakes
Bake in the preheated oven for 22-24 minutes, or until the centers of the cheesecake minis are set but exhibit a slight jiggle. Keep an eye on them as they bake; the edges might begin to puff up slightly while the centers remain a touch soft, which is ideal for achieving that silky texture.
Step 7: Cool the Cheesecakes
Once baked, remove the muffin tin from the oven and let it cool at room temperature for about 30 minutes. This cooling helps prevent excess moisture from forming during refrigeration. Afterward, carefully transfer the Lemon Cheesecake Minis to the refrigerator and allow them to chill for at least 4 hours, or ideally overnight, for the best texture and flavor.
Step 8: Top and Serve
Before serving, spoon generous dollops of lemon curd on top of each cheesecake mini for a delightful finishing touch. Optionally, add fresh raspberries for a pop of color and tartness. The combination of toppings enhances not just the flavor but also the presentation, making your Lemon Cheesecake Minis a visual and culinary delight!

Lemon Cheesecake Minis Recipe Variations
Feel free to personalize your Lemon Cheesecake Minis with these delightful twists that will tickle your taste buds!
-
Gingersnap Crust: Replace vanilla wafers with crushed gingersnap cookies for a spiced, flavorful base. The warmth of the ginger will complement the zesty lemon beautifully.
-
Berry Topping: Swap lemon curd for fresh berry compote. A mix of strawberries and blueberries offers a colorful, sweet topping that brightens each bite!
-
Chocolate Drizzle: Add a chocolate ganache topping for a rich contrast to the tangy cheesecake. The marriage of chocolate and lemon creates a sinfully good experience.
-
Nutty Crunch: Stir in crushed nuts, like pistachios or almonds, into the crust for extra texture and flavor. Their crunch will provide a delightful surprise with each mini.
-
Almond Extract: For a unique flavor twist, substitute part of the vanilla extract with almond extract. This nutty undertone pairs beautifully with the creamy filling.
-
Seasonal Fruits: Top your minis with seasonal fruits such as peaches or figs, depending on what’s fresh. Each fruit brings its own distinct flair, making your dessert a seasonal celebration.
-
Spiced Cheesecake: Add a dash of cinnamon or nutmeg to the cheesecake batter for a warm, spiced flavor. This twist is perfect for cozy gatherings.

Expert Tips for Lemon Cheesecake Minis Recipe
-
Room Temperature Cream Cheese: Make sure your cream cheese is at room temperature to ensure a smooth and creamy filling that blends perfectly with the other ingredients.
-
Avoid Overmixing: Once you add the eggs, mix just until combined to prevent cracks on the surface of your cheesecake minis.
-
Proper Cooling: Allow the cheesecakes to cool at room temperature before refrigerating them. This helps avoid excess moisture that can affect texture.
-
Chill Overnight: For the best flavor and texture, chill your Lemon Cheesecake Minis overnight. This waiting time allows the flavors to meld beautifully.
-
Flexible Toppings: Get creative with your toppings! Lemon curd is a classic, but don’t hesitate to try other fruits or flavored extracts with your Lemon Cheesecake Minis recipe.
Make Ahead Options
These delightful Lemon Cheesecake Minis are perfect for meal prep, saving you time on busy days! You can prepare the cheesecake filling up to 24 hours in advance—simply mix all ingredients and store it in an airtight container in the refrigerator. The crust can also be prepped by placing the vanilla wafer cookies in the muffin cups ahead of time. When ready to bake, fill each cup with the prepared filling and bake for about 22-24 minutes. To maintain their creamy texture, allow the cheesecakes to cool completely before refrigerating them for at least 4 hours or ideally overnight. Finish with lemon curd topping just before serving to keep everything fresh and delicious!
How to Store and Freeze Lemon Cheesecake Minis
Fridge: Store the lemon cheesecake minis in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. This keeps them fresh and creamy, ready for your indulgence.
Freezer: For longer storage, freeze the cheesecake minis without toppings for up to a month. Wrap each mini well in plastic wrap and place them in an airtight container.
Thawing: To enjoy your frozen lemon cheesecake minis, simply transfer them to the fridge overnight before serving. This gentle thawing helps maintain their delightful texture.
Serving: When ready to serve, top with lemon curd or fresh raspberries if desired. These final touches bring back that burst of flavor to your Lemon Cheesecake Minis recipe!

Lemon Cheesecake Minis Recipe FAQs
How do I choose the best lemons for this recipe?
Absolutely! When selecting lemons, look for ones that are firm, heavy for their size, and have a bright, vibrant yellow color. Avoid any that have dark spots all over, as this may indicate overripeness or spoilage. Fresh lemons will provide the zesty flavor essential for your Lemon Cheesecake Minis Recipe.
How should I store leftover cheesecake minis?
Store your lemon cheesecake minis in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. This keeps them fresh and ready for those afternoon cravings. Just make sure to separate layers with parchment paper if stacking them to avoid sticking.
Can I freeze Lemon Cheesecake Minis?
Yes, you can! To freeze, wait until the cheesecake minis are fully cooled and without any toppings. Wrap each mini tightly in plastic wrap and place them in an airtight container. They can be frozen for up to a month. For the best texture, thaw them overnight in the fridge before serving.
What if my cheesecakes crack during baking?
No worries! Cracking can occur if the filling is overmixed or the oven is too hot. To prevent this, mix the batter just until combined after adding eggs. Baking at a lower temperature and avoiding opening the oven door during baking can also help. If cracks do happen, you can always hide them under a generous layer of lemon curd or fresh fruits!
Are these cheesecake minis suitable for those with allergies?
Great question! The Lemon Cheesecake Minis Recipe contains common allergens such as dairy and eggs. To accommodate dietary restrictions, you could experiment with vegan cream cheese and egg substitutes like flax eggs for a plant-based option. Always check ingredient labels and consider your guests’ allergies when preparing!
